請問一下有關音效卡驅動程式的問題

如果您覺得您的問題不屬於 debian desktop 或是 debian server 版的範圍內,請在這裡發問。

版主: mufa

請問一下有關音效卡驅動程式的問題

文章訪客 » 週一 2月 26, 2007 10:21 am

我的音效卡是內建的,是用 ALC655
在印像中,之前裝 debain 的時候,他是可以自已找到的
但就在前幾天重灌之後(我是用 netinstall 的)
進xwindow 的時候卻說
代碼: 選擇全部
Sound server informational message:
Error while initializing the sound driver:
device: default can't be opened for playback (No such device)
The sound server will continue, using the null output device.


請問一下,我現在應該怎麼確定這個 kernel 有沒有支緩到 ALC655
並且,將驅動程式模組載入

謝謝
訪客
 

文章訪客 » 週一 2月 26, 2007 10:00 pm

我是原 po
剛剛看了一下,果然在/dev 下沒有 audio 這個裝置
這樣是說,沒有正確驅動到嗎?

但是,又有一件很奇怪的事 .......
就是剛剛在 xmms 中用 OSS 居然會有聲音 .....
真的不知道現在是什麼情形 .....

雖然用 oss 可以,但卻沒有辦法多工
所以還是請大家能幫忙思考一下,為什麼會有這種情形以及如何載入正確的模組

謝謝
訪客
 

文章訪客 » 週二 2月 27, 2007 9:22 am

sound server 啟用失效。

xmms 應該是直接用 /dev/dsp 輸出,所以有聲音
(表示你的音效趨動模組已經有正確掛入了)

建議貼一下
代碼: 選擇全部
lsmod | grep snd

的結果。
訪客
 

文章訪客 » 週二 2月 27, 2007 10:29 am

Try it.
aptitude install linux-sound-base alsa-base
訪客
 

文章訪客 » 週二 2月 27, 2007 8:34 pm

非常感謝,在 install linux-sound-base alsa-base 之後
可以正常動作了,想請問一下

這是怎麼一回事呢?

再次謝謝大家的幫忙
訪客
 

文章阿信 » 週三 2月 28, 2007 2:00 pm

安裝Alsa可以模擬OSS和多工聲音輸出
頭像
阿信
版面大總管
版面大總管
 
文章: 4756
註冊時間: 週二 9月 03, 2002 11:58 pm
來自: 台灣 - 嘉義

文章訪客 » 週三 2月 28, 2007 6:14 pm

大致上來說
ALSA 必須作一些相關的設定,
才能讓系統正確的抓到正確的音效晶片。

若好奇可以查一下
dpkg -L alsa-base
訪客
 

文章訪客 » 週三 2月 28, 2007 8:46 pm

嗯嗯,謝謝大家的解說

這樣是像第三位訪客兄說的
音效驅動模組已經有正確掛入,只是 sound server
沒有起來了而已,而裝了 alsa 之後可以正常,是因為 alsa 這個
sound server 有正常起動囉?
訪客
 

文章阿信 » 週四 3月 01, 2007 9:19 am

Anonymous 寫:嗯嗯,謝謝大家的解說

這樣是像第三位訪客兄說的
音效驅動模組已經有正確掛入,只是 sound server
沒有起來了而已,而裝了 alsa 之後可以正常,是因為 alsa 這個
sound server 有正常起動囉?


Alsa 不是sound server,它跟OSS一樣是一套音效驅動系統,或是直接稱驅動程式

有別於OSS的單一device node(dev/dsp)所佔用的單工,alsa能直接處理多工(程式要支援)。

Alsa也能模擬OSS,只要載入snd_pcm_oss就可以了,為了相容舊版只能使用OSS的軟體
頭像
阿信
版面大總管
版面大總管
 
文章: 4756
註冊時間: 週二 9月 03, 2002 11:58 pm
來自: 台灣 - 嘉義


回到 debian misc

誰在線上

正在瀏覽這個版面的使用者:沒有註冊會員 和 1 位訪客

cron